A VIENNA (DU PAQUIER) BEAKER AND SAUCER
CIRCA 1725-30
Each side of the beaker painted with Orientals by low tables on terraces, within gilt shaped quatrefoil cartouches divided by large flowering branches of indianische Blumen, each with a bird perched among them, the saucer similarly decorated with indianische Blumen around a central cartouche, with elaborate scroll and shaped diaper panel borders and gilt band rims, the reverse of the saucer with flowerheads (saucer with flaking to enamels, beaker with minute flakes to enamels and wear to rim)
